Struct Transmit 

Source
pub struct Transmit<T>
where T: AsRef<[u8]>,
{ pub data: T, pub transport: TransportType, pub from: SocketAddr, pub to: SocketAddr, }
Expand description

A piece of data that needs to, or has been transmitted

Fields§

§data: T

The data blob

§transport: TransportType

The transport for the transmission

§from: SocketAddr

The source address of the transmission

§to: SocketAddr

The destination address of the transmission

Implementations§

Source§

impl<T> Transmit<T>
where T: AsRef<[u8]>,

Source

pub fn new( data: T, transport: TransportType, from: SocketAddr, to: SocketAddr, ) -> Transmit<T>

Construct a new Transmit with the specifid data and 5-tuple.

Source

pub fn reinterpret_data<O, F>(self, f: F) -> Transmit<O>
where O: AsRef<[u8]>, F: FnOnce(T) -> O,

Reinterpret the data of a Transmit into a different type.

§Examples
let local_addr = "10.0.0.1:1000".parse().unwrap();
let remote_addr = "10.0.0.2:2000".parse().unwrap();
let slice = [42; 8];
let transmit = Transmit::new(slice.clone(), TransportType::Udp, local_addr, remote_addr);
// change the data type of the `Transmit` into a `Vec<u8>`.
let transmit = transmit.reinterpret_data(|data| data.to_vec());
assert_eq!(transmit.data, slice.as_slice());
Source§

impl Transmit<Data<'_>>

Source

pub fn into_owned<'b>(self) -> Transmit<Data<'b>>

Construct a new owned Transmit from a provided Transmit
